The legs of a right triangle measure 8 cm and 6 cm respectively. How long is the longest side of the triangle?

a.12
b.10
c.14
d.11

1 Answer

4 votes

Answer:

b. 10

Explanation:

Based on the Pythagoras Theorem, the longest side of a right-angled triangle is:
\sqrt{a^(2)+b^(2) } where a and b are the legs of the triangle.

Longest side of triangle =
\sqrt{8^(2)+6^(2)}

=
√(64+36)

=
√(100)

= 10
